Limerick is a city in Ireland that is known for its rich history and vibrant culture. It is located in the province of Munster and is part of the Mid-West Region. The city is the third largest city in the Republic of Ireland and is a major economic and cultural hub.
Now, let's talk about the Irish name for Limerick. The English name "Limerick" comes from the Irish word "Luimneach." This word is derived from the Old Irish word "Luimnech," which means "a bare or stony place." The name is thought to have originated from the fact that the area was once a barren and rocky landscape.
The county in which Limerick city is located is called County Limerick in English. In Irish, it is known as "Contae Luimnigh." The term "Contae" means "county" in Irish, and "Luimnigh" is the genitive form of "Luimneach," which refers to Limerick. So, the Irish name for Limerick city is "Luimneach," and the Irish name for County Limerick is "Contae Luimnigh."

County Limerick (Irish: Contae Luimnigh) is a county in Ireland. It is located in the province of Munster, and is also part of the Mid-West Region. It is named after the city of Limerick. Limerick City and County Council is the local council for the county.
